CASE MANAGER D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Prepare, update, and monitor annual Individualized Service Plans
- Attend monthly staff meetings and trainings as directed
- Assist persons in identifying and accessing community resources
- Advocate for services and supports to meet the person’s needs
- Understand and adhere to Agency Policy and Procedures
- Possess an understanding of waiver services available and processes by which those are obtained
- Compliance to privacy and confidentiality practices
- Complete all face to face and ancillary contacts required for caseload and complete documentation of contacts
